If the compound interest on a sum for 2 years at 12.5% is Rs. 510, find the SI.
ARs. 400
BRs. 480
CRs. 450
DRs. 500
✓ Correct Answer: B — Rs. 480
CI = P[(1+1/8)^2 - 1] = P[17/64]. 510 = P(17/64) => P = 1920. SI = (1920*2*12.5)/100 = 480.
